About this episode
GENXZ is a miniseries that tackles Lebanese political, economic and social issues from a youth perspective. For this episode Amira Kazoun joins as co-host and we introduce Wael Taleb to the podcast, a reporter and features writer at L'Orient Today and a gifted journalist.
